Bon Vivant Cakes Designer Emily Nejad's Guide to Chicago

From finding the best Sunday brunch spot to attending the latest museum exhibits, this Albany Park resident knows her way around Chicago.

Emily Nejad's love affair with baking began when she and her red KitchenAid mixer crafted the ultimate birthday cake for a friend. It featured five delicious layers, a blend of cheerful colors and ornate decor, all with intricate moving parts. Fast forward a few months, and her company, Bon Vivant Cakes, was born.

As a cake artist and dessert designer in Chicago, Nejad takes pride in getting to know her fellow Chicagoans, not only for their tastebuds, but for their unique passions and hobbies, as well. That's why her favorite aspect of the city is the people. "We’re a city of optimists and hustlers who work hard to take care of each other," Nejad proudly states.

On the off chance that she's not perfecting one of her lavish cakes (or performing with her band, Celine Neon), you might find Nejad strolling through Humboldt Park on a glorious summer morning or hitting Koval Distillery for a tasting tour. Since Nejad has deemed Chicago the "best city ever," we decided to pick her brain and find out just why. Here are some of her must-see destinations around the windy city:

What neighborhood do you live in? Albany Park

What’s your occupation? Cake artist and dessert designer

Describe Chicago in three words: Best city ever

What’s your favorite overall Chicago restaurant? Band of Bohemia

Best sushi: It’s too cold for sushi — I’m all about the pho from LD Pho during the winter.

Best Italian food: La Scarola

Best dessert: Spinning J — it’s pie heaven!

Best pizza: Coalfire

Best spot for a quick lunch: Brazilian Bowl

Best food truck: 5411 Empanadas

Best spot for a romantic date: Koval Distillery for a tasting tour

Best glass of wine: my couch

Best Sunday brunch: Luella’s Southern Kitchen

Best spot for a power business meeting: My co-working space! I'm opening my own kitchen space this spring! It'll be an event and co-working space in Albany Park called Maven.

Best cup of coffee: Oromo Cafe

Best steak: Tango Sur

Best craft cocktail: The Promontory

What hotel would you recommend for your out of town guests? The Guesthouse Hotel

Favorite shopping venue or boutique: Humboldt House

Best gym or fitness studio: Elena of Flybarre at Flywheel Sports is amazing!

Best spa: Wholistic Skincare Specialists in Lincoln Park — LaTonya is a goddess.

Favorite charity event or organization: Deborah’s Place, a nonprofit that helps women experiencing homelessness

Favorite cultural event: Inherit Chicago! It’s a month-long, multi-event festival celebration of arts, conversation, and food happening across 30 neighborhood-based heritage museums and cultural centers, all members of the Chicago Cultural Alliance.

Favorite cultural institution: Chicago Cultural Alliance

What’s the best museum or current exhibit in Chicago? I’m blown away by Nina Chanel Abney’s work, currently on display at the Chicago Cultural Center.

Best iconic Chicago landmark to visit: The Green Mill Cocktail Lounge

What’s your all-time favorite spot in Chicago? Humboldt Park on a summer morning.
